How do you get into Royal Military College of Canada?

Applicants must meet one of the following conditions to be eligible to apply to RMC:

  1. Be an applicant to a subsidized education entry program of the Canadian Armed Forces such as the ROTP.
  2. Be a current serving member of the CAF and have completed basic MOSID (Military Occupational Structure Indication Code) training.

What grades do I need for RMC?

Students must have an overall average of 75% on the best 6 courses completed in grade 12 (this includes the required courses).

How much do RMC students get paid?

Tuition and books are covered by the government, and officer cadets are paid an annual salary of approximately $28,000, which, after covering room and board and some other costs, still leaves about $1,000 in spending money each month. But the funding isn’t for nothing.

Is RMC a college or university?

A “university with a difference,” the Royal Military College of Canada (RMC) is a full degree granting university that caters to three distinct academic groups. First, RMC educates and trains on-campus students for careers as commissioned officers in the Canadian Armed Forces.

Do you need Grade 12 to join the Canadian army?

To join the Canadian Forces, you need a minimum of Secondary IV in Quebec or grade 10 education for the rest of Canada. If you wish to join the Forces as an officer, you need to have or be working toward a Bachelor’s Degree.

Do you get paid in RMC?

Officer and Naval Cadets are also paid a monthly salary (from which mandatory room, board and mess dues are deducted), undergo military occupation training, and if required, second language training during the summer months, and receive full medical and dental care at no cost.

What is life at RMC like?

The College is fully residential. Cadets (other than UTPNCM) live together in a military environment. All cadets are required to take part in a demanding routine designed to raise them to a high standard of physical fitness, drill, dress and deportment.

Can you drop out of RMC?

A student who wishes to withdraw from their programme must submit a request in writing to their Programme Chair. The registrar’s office will inform the student that his/her file has been closed at RMC. Voluntary programme withdrawals after the 4th week of term normally result in forfeiture of tuition fees.

What is the maximum age to join the Canadian Forces?

You are between 16 and 57 years old.
If you are under 18 years old, you will need permission from your parent or guardian.

How many years do you have to serve in the Canadian Army?

The time you spend in the Regular Force can range from three to nine years, depending on the job you choose. If you enrol through a paid education program, your length of service will be longer. Please speak with a recruiter for details specific to your situation.
